Fans holding out hope of seeing Connor Hawke in Arrow anytime soon may have been delivered a bit of a blow today, as Executive Producer Marc Guggenheim told TVLine that they're focusing on putting the development of Oliver Queen's illegitimate, unknown child "in the right context" and that it might not happen this year or in the foreseeable future.

"Half of our job is coming up with ideas, and the other half is exercising judgement in terms of the right time to play those ideas," Guggenheim said. "We also need to have that moment happen in the right context. So is it Year 3, is it Year 10…? I don't know. We've put it out there and we've got some cool ideas about where to go with it, should we do it, but we haven't committed to actually doing it or even when to do it."

Arrow will return in October 8 at 8 p.m. on The CW.
